選單
×
   ❮     
HTML CSS JAVASCRIPT SQL PYTHON JAVA PHP How to W3.CSS C C++ C# BOOTSTRAP REACT MYSQL JQUERY EXCEL XML DJANGO NUMPY PANDAS NODEJS R TYPESCRIPT ANGULAR GIT POSTGRESQL MONGODB ASP AI GO KOTLIN SASS VUE DSA GEN AI SCIPY AWS CYBERSECURITY DATA SCIENCE
     ❯   

什麼是 SQL?


HTML

SQL 代表 **S**tructured **Q**uery **L**anguage (結構化查詢語言)。

SQL 是用於訪問資料庫的標準語言。

SQL 自 1987 年起一直是國際標準 (ISO)。


SQL 語句

要訪問資料庫,你需要使用 SQL 語句。

以下 SQL 語句從名為 "Customers" 的資料庫表中選擇所有記錄。

示例

SELECT * FROM Customers;
自己動手試一試 »

資料庫表

資料庫通常包含一個或多個表。

每個表都有一個名稱,如 "Customers" 或 "Orders"。

下面是 "Customers" 表的一部分:

ID CustomerName ContactName Address City PostalCode Country
1

Alfreds Futterkiste Maria Anders Obere Str. 57 Berlin 12209 Germany
2 Ana Trujillo Emparedados y helados Ana Trujillo Avda. de la Constitución 2222 México D.F. 05021 Mexico
3 Antonio Moreno Taquería Antonio Moreno Mataderos 2312 México D.F. 05023 Mexico
4

Around the Horn Thomas Hardy 120 Hanover Sq. London WA1 1DP UK
5 Berglunds snabbköp Christina Berglund Berguvsvägen 8 Luleå S-958 22 Sweden

上表包含五個記錄(每位客戶一條)和七列。

  1. CustomerID (ID)
  2. CustomerName
  3. ContactName
  4. Address
  5. City
  6. PostalCode
  7. Country

最重要的 SQL 語句

  • SELECT - 從資料庫中提取資料
  • UPDATE - 更新資料庫中的資料
  • DELETE - 刪除資料庫中的資料
  • INSERT INTO - 向資料庫插入新資料
  • CREATE DATABASE - 建立新資料庫
  • ALTER DATABASE - 修改資料庫
  • CREATE TABLE - 建立新表
  • ALTER TABLE - 修改表
  • DROP TABLE - 刪除表
  • CREATE INDEX - 建立索引(搜尋鍵)
  • DROP INDEX - 刪除索引

SQL 關鍵字不區分大小寫:select 和 SELECT 是相同的。


完整的 SQL 教程

以上是對 SQL 的簡要介紹。

如需完整的 SQL 教程,請訪問 W3Schools SQL 教程


×

聯絡銷售

如果您想將 W3Schools 服務用於教育機構、團隊或企業,請傳送電子郵件給我們
sales@w3schools.com

報告錯誤

如果您想報告錯誤,或想提出建議,請傳送電子郵件給我們
help@w3schools.com

W3Schools 經過最佳化,旨在方便學習和培訓。示例可能經過簡化,以提高閱讀和學習體驗。教程、參考資料和示例會不斷審查,以避免錯誤,但我們無法保證所有內容的完全正確性。使用 W3Schools 即表示您已閱讀並接受我們的使用條款Cookie 和隱私政策

版權所有 1999-2024 Refsnes Data。保留所有權利。W3Schools 由 W3.CSS 提供支援